How To Fix /PF1/MSG_EH013 - Response type &1 for &2 was determined from exception control


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/PF1/MSG_EH -

  • Message number: 013

  • Message text: Response type &1 for &2 was determined from exception control

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/PF1/MSG_EH013 - Response type &1 for &2 was determined from exception control ?

    The SAP error message /PF1/MSG_EH013 typically indicates an issue related to the response type being determined from exception control in the context of the SAP Event Management (EM) module. This message is often encountered when there is a mismatch or an issue with the configuration of exception handling.

    Cause:

    The error message can occur due to several reasons, including:

    1. Configuration Issues: The response type for the event is not properly configured in the exception handling settings.
    2. Missing or Incorrect Data: The data related to the event or exception might be incomplete or incorrect, leading to the system being unable to determine the appropriate response type.
    3. Custom Logic: If there are custom enhancements or modifications in the exception handling logic, they might not be functioning as expected.
    4. Inconsistent Master Data: Issues with master data related to the event or the business process can also lead to this error.

    Solution:

    To resolve the error, you can take the following steps:

    1. Check Exception Control Configuration:

      • Navigate to the configuration settings for exception handling in SAP EM.
      • Ensure that the response types are correctly defined for the relevant events and exceptions.
    2. Review Event Data:

      • Check the event data associated with the error message. Ensure that all required fields are populated and that the data is consistent.
    3. Debug Custom Logic:

      • If there are any custom enhancements or modifications, review the code to ensure that it is correctly determining the response type based on the event and exception.
    4. Consult Documentation:

      •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to exception handling and response types for any specific guidance or updates.
    5. Testing:

      • After making changes, test the scenario again to see if the error persists. It may be helpful to create a test event to isolate the issue.
    6. SAP Support:

      • If the issue cannot be resolved through the above steps,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ance. Provide them with the error message details and any relevant configuration settings.
